
The art of describing the world is central to science and engineering. Just as a painting can be described speck by speck or by its dominant colors, a signal—be it sound, light, or voltage—can be represented in different languages that reveal distinct aspects of its nature. Signal representation is the study of these languages, providing the tools to transform complex, raw data into a form that is structured, insightful, and computationally simple. The core challenge this addresses is how to choose the right "lens" to view a signal, unlocking hidden patterns that are invisible in its original form. This article will guide you through this foundational concept in signal processing.
First, in "Principles and Mechanisms," we will explore the fundamental building blocks of signals. We will contrast the "atomic" view of a signal built from instantaneous impulses with the "harmonic" view of a signal composed of pure oscillations. We will see how complex numbers elegantly unify these concepts and learn about the profound trade-offs between time and frequency, as captured by the Nyquist-Shannon sampling theorem. Then, in "Applications and Interdisciplinary Connections," we will witness these theories in action. We will discover how choices in representation enable everything from high-fidelity digital audio and modern wireless communications to powerful data compression techniques, revealing how abstract mathematics forms the bedrock of our digital world.
Imagine you want to describe a complex painting. You could go about it in two ways. You could create a fantastically detailed map, listing the exact color and location of every single speck of paint on the canvas. Or, you could describe it in broad strokes, noting that it's made of 50% sky blue, 30% grass green, and 20% sunshine yellow, with various shades and textures. Both descriptions can be complete, yet they tell very different stories about the painting.
The world of signals—be it the sound of a violin, the voltage in a circuit, or the radio waves carrying your Wi-Fi signal—can be described in similarly different, yet equally powerful, ways. The art of signal representation is about choosing the right language to reveal a signal's hidden structure and make complex problems astonishingly simple.
Let's start with the first approach: describing the painting speck by speck. What is the most fundamental, indivisible "speck" of a signal? In the continuous world, it's an idea of pure genius: the Dirac delta function, or impulse, denoted by . You can think of it as an infinitely tall, infinitely narrow spike right at , whose total area is exactly one. It’s a strange beast, but its one magical property is all that matters. It has the power to sift through a signal and pick out its value at a single point in time. This is called the sifting property:
What does this equation truly say? It reveals that any well-behaved signal, , can be thought of as a seamless sum (an integral) of an infinite number of impulses. Each impulse, , is located at a specific time and is weighted by the signal's value at that very instant, . So, to build a ramp signal (where is the step function that is zero for and one otherwise), we simply need to tell the integral to use the value of the ramp itself as the weighting function. The integral then dutifully assembles the signal, instant by instant, from these weighted impulses. Even a simple operation like shifting the signal by to get translates directly into using a shifted weighting function, , inside the integral. This representation is powerful because it's universal; it can describe any signal by its point-by-point construction.
In the digital world, this "atomic" view is even more intuitive. A discrete-time signal is just a sequence of numbers, a list of values at integer time steps. Here, the unit impulse is simply a 1 at and 0 everywhere else. Any discrete signal can be written as a sum of scaled and shifted impulses. For a sparse signal that is non-zero only at a few points, say with values at times , its representation is simply:
This isn't just a notational trick. If you want to calculate the total energy of this signal, which is the sum of its squared values, this representation makes it trivial. The impulses are "orthogonal"—a shifted impulse has no overlap with if . This means all the cross-terms vanish when you square the sum, and the total energy beautifully simplifies to just the sum of the squares of the individual measurements, .
Now for the second approach: describing the painting by its constituent colors. In the world of signals, the primary "colors" are sinusoids—pure, endless oscillations like the hum of a tuning fork. Many signals we encounter, especially in electronics and physics, are either pure sinusoids or can be built from them.
However, working directly with trigonometric functions like sines and cosines is notoriously clumsy. Adding two shifted cosine waves requires wrestling with cumbersome trig identities. There must be a better way. And there is, thanks to one of the most beautiful equations in all of mathematics, Euler's formula:
This is the Rosetta Stone connecting oscillations and complex numbers. It tells us that the cosine function is simply the real part of a rotating vector, , in the complex plane. A signal like can be seen as the "shadow" of a vector of length rotating with angular velocity , starting at an angle . To simplify our lives, we can forget the rotation and the shadow-casting for a moment and just capture the two essential pieces of information—amplitude and starting phase —in a single complex number. This static snapshot is the phasor: .
The beauty of this is that it turns calculus into algebra. Let's see it in action. To convert a time-domain signal like into a phasor, we first use the identity to put it into our standard cosine form. This yields . From here, we can simply read off the amplitude and phase to get the phasor .
The real power of phasors shines when signals interact. If you add two signals, like and , you simply add their phasors as if they were vectors. The phasor for is , and the phasor for is (or ). Their sum is , which in polar form is . This immediately tells us the resulting signal is —a result that is much more tedious to derive using trigonometry.
Furthermore, when a sinusoidal signal passes through a linear time-invariant (LTI) system, like an electrical circuit, the effect of the system in steady-state is just to multiply the input phasor by a complex number—the system's frequency response. If a system doubles the amplitude and adds a phase lead of , its effect is captured by the phasor . Finding the output signal becomes a simple multiplication of complex numbers, a vastly simpler task than solving differential equations.
Phasors are wonderful for pure tones, but what about more complex sounds, like a musical chord or a square wave? The French mathematician Jean-Baptiste Joseph Fourier showed that any periodic signal—any signal that repeats itself over and over—can be represented as a sum of sinusoids. This sum, the Fourier Series, is like a recipe for the signal. It consists of a constant (DC) component and a series of sinusoids whose frequencies are integer multiples of the signal's fundamental frequency.
Using the complex exponential form, the recipe looks elegant: The complex numbers are the Fourier coefficients. They are the heart of the representation, telling us the amplitude and phase of each harmonic component. For example, if we are told that a real signal's only non-zero coefficients are , , and , we can immediately reconstruct the signal. The term is the DC offset. The and terms combine to form a single cosine wave at twice the fundamental frequency. The signal is simply . The entire complexity of the original waveform is perfectly captured in a short list of numbers.
How do we apply these ideas to modern communications, like a radio signal carrying a voice message? Here, we have a low-frequency information signal (the voice) riding on a high-frequency carrier wave. It would be inefficient to analyze the fast carrier oscillations every time we just want to know about the slower message.
The solution is to use the analytic signal, . The real-world signal we transmit, , is just the real part of this more abstract complex signal. The analytic signal itself is factored into two parts: a fast-spinning carrier and a slow-moving complex envelope .
The magic is that all the useful information is now contained in the complex envelope. This envelope is itself a complex signal, which can be broken down into its real and imaginary parts: . These are called the in-phase () and quadrature () components. They represent two independent channels of information that can be carried on a single carrier wave. For a given analytic signal, we can identify these components by simply isolating the complex envelope and finding its real and imaginary parts. This very principle is the engine behind modern high-speed data transmission in Wi-Fi, 4G, and 5G.
Finally, we arrive at one of the deepest and most practical questions in all of signal processing: can we perfectly capture a continuous, analog signal using a finite number of discrete samples? The Nyquist-Shannon sampling theorem gives us the answer, and it's a conditional "yes". It states that perfect reconstruction is possible, but only if two conditions are met: the signal must be band-limited (its frequency content must be zero above some maximum frequency), and the sampling rate must be at least twice this maximum frequency.
This brings us to a beautiful paradox. Consider one of the simplest-looking signals imaginable: a perfect rectangular pulse. It's on for a bit, then it's off. Nothing could seem more straightforward. Yet, if we sample this signal, even at an absurdly high rate, and try to reconstruct it with a perfect filter, we will fail. The reconstructed signal will always have ripples and overshoots near the sharp edges.
Why? Because the rectangular pulse is not band-limited. To create those perfectly sharp, instantaneous edges in the time domain, you need an infinite range of frequencies in the frequency domain. The Fourier transform of a rectangle is a sinc function, which ripples out to infinity. When you sample this signal, no matter how fast, the infinite tails of its frequency spectrum get "folded" back into the main part of the spectrum. This spectral overlap, called aliasing, is an incurable corruption. The high frequencies, which are essential for creating the sharp edges, masquerade as low frequencies, and the original information is lost forever.
This reveals a profound truth about the nature of signals, a kind of uncertainty principle. A signal cannot be perfectly confined in both the time domain and the frequency domain simultaneously. The sharper and more localized a signal is in time, the more spread out and infinite it must be in frequency. This trade-off is not a limitation of our technology; it is a fundamental property of the universe, woven into the very fabric of how we describe change and information.
In our journey so far, we have learned the basic grammar for the language of signals. We have seen how to describe them, manipulate them, and view them in different domains. But this is like learning the rules of chess; the real excitement comes from seeing the game played by masters. Now, we shall explore the poetry of signal representation. We will see how these mathematical ideas are not mere abstractions but are the very blueprints for our digital world, the tools we use to capture, transmit, and understand the universe of information around us. This is where the mathematics breathes, where abstract concepts become tangible realities like crystal-clear audio, instant global communication, and sharp medical images.
Let's start with the most fundamental challenge of the digital age: how do you take a piece of the real world, like the rich, continuous pressure wave of a sound, and store it in the rigidly discrete world of a computer? The world is continuous; a computer's memory is a grid of finite bits. To get from one to the other, we must draw a map, and every map involves choices and compromises.
Imagine you are designing a high-fidelity audio system. The signal, once captured by a microphone and converted to a voltage, is normalized to a convenient range, say between -1.0 and 1.0. You have 16 bits to store each sample. How do you use them? This is not just a technical question; it's a question of resource allocation. A fixed-point representation, known as a format, forces us to decide: how many bits, , should we reserve for the integer part of the number (for the large-scale values), and how many, , for the fractional part (for the fine details)? For a high-fidelity audio signal that lives entirely within , there are no large integer values to worry about. The action is all in the subtle nuances, the delicate variations close to zero. The wisest choice, then, is to devote as many bits as possible to precision. We choose a format like , using only one bit for the sign and the (zero) integer part, and a luxurious 15 bits for the fractional part. This allows us to represent the signal with maximum fidelity, sacrificing a dynamic range we never needed in the first place.
But this act of mapping from the continuous to the discrete has consequences. What happens to a value that falls between the cracks of our fractional steps? It must be rounded to the nearest representable value. And what if a sudden, loud sound spike exceeds our range? To prevent the digital representation from nonsensically "wrapping around" due to the nature of two's complement arithmetic—which would turn a loud clap into a deafening digital buzz—the hardware must enforce saturation. The value is simply clipped to the maximum or minimum representable value. The process of converting a real number to its final integer code involves scaling, rounding, and saturating, a careful three-step dance to tame the infinite continuum into a finite set of bits without creating ugly artifacts. This is the invisible, foundational engineering that underpins every digital song you've ever heard.
Once a signal is safely inside a machine, how do we think about it? One of the most powerful ideas in all of science is to understand a complex thing by breaking it down into its simplest possible components. What is the simplest component, the fundamental "atom," of a discrete-time signal? It is a single, instantaneous blip of value 1 at a single point in time, and zero everywhere else: the unit impulse, .
A beautiful and profound property, sometimes called the sifting property, tells us that any signal can be seen as a grand procession of these impulses, each occurring at a different time and scaled by the signal's value at that moment, . Mathematically, this is written as: This might look like a mere tautology, but its power is immense. It means that if we want to understand how any linear, time-invariant system (like a filter or an amplifier) will behave, we don't need to test it with every possible input signal. We only need to see how it responds to one signal: a single unit impulse. Its response to that one impulse, called the "impulse response," becomes a complete fingerprint of the system. To find the output for any input signal , we simply add up the scaled and shifted copies of the impulse response, a process known as convolution.
This representational shift from viewing a signal as a list of numbers to a sum of impulses makes complex operations startlingly clear. Consider the process of upsampling by a factor , where we insert zeros between each sample of our original signal. What does this look like in the language of impulses? If our original signal was a parade of impulses, the upsampled signal is simply the same parade, but now the impulses are spaced times further apart. The representation changes from to . The underlying structure of the operation is laid bare by the representation.
For centuries, we have been taught that imaginary numbers are somehow less "real" than real ones. Yet in signal processing, we often find that the most insightful way to look at a very real physical phenomenon, like an oscillating wave, is to represent it in the complex plane. A real-world oscillation, like a simple cosine wave, has both an amplitude (how big is the oscillation?) and a phase (where are we in the cycle?). A single real number struggles to hold both pieces of information simultaneously.
The solution is an act of brilliant imagination: for any real signal , we construct a unique "shadow" signal, (its Hilbert transform), and define a new complex signal, the analytic signal, as . When we do this, the unruly world of trigonometric identities melts away into the clean, beautiful geometry of the complex plane. Our signal is no longer just a wave bobbing up and down; it becomes a vector rotating in the complex plane, which we can write in polar form as . The magnitude of this vector, , is the instantaneous amplitude or envelope of the signal, and its angle, , is its instantaneous phase.
This representation is incredibly powerful. Consider the challenge of demodulating an AM radio signal, which consists of a high-frequency carrier wave whose amplitude is modulated by a lower-frequency audio signal. In the analytic signal representation, this complicated signal becomes a simple picture: a vector spinning very fast (at the carrier frequency), whose length is slowly changing according to the audio message. To recover the audio, we don't need complicated electronic filters; we just need to ask at every moment, "How long is the vector?" The demodulated signal is simply the magnitude, .
This same technique solves another deep question: what is the "frequency" of a signal whose frequency is constantly changing? Think of a "chirp" signal, common in radar and sonar systems, whose pitch slides up or down over time. The analytic signal provides a perfect, unambiguous answer. The instantaneous frequency, , is simply how fast the representative vector is spinning at any given moment: . A deeply intuitive physical concept is given a precise, elegant, and computable mathematical definition, all thanks to the courage of embracing complex numbers to describe real phenomena.
We have seen that a change in representation can reveal hidden structures. But this raises a crucial question: is there one "best" representation? The answer is no. The world of signals is like a rich, detailed tapestry. You can look at it from afar to see the whole picture, or you can get up close to examine the individual threads. But, as Heisenberg's uncertainty principle teaches us in a different context, you cannot do both perfectly at the same time. The more precisely you resolve a signal in time (asking "when" did something happen), the less precisely you can resolve it in frequency (asking "what" notes were played), and vice-versa.
The art of signal representation is the art of choosing the right lens for the job, a lens that manages this time-frequency trade-off in a way that is useful for your specific question. In Problem 1765715, we compare two different ways of creating a time-frequency "map" of a signal. The spectrogram, which is based on the linear Short-Time Fourier Transform (STFT), is a cautious approach. It provides a useful, if slightly blurry, picture, and because of its mathematical linearity, any interference "artifacts" it creates are confined to regions where the signal components actually overlap in time and frequency. In contrast, the Wigner-Ville Distribution (WVD) is far more ambitious. It is a bilinear representation that promises perfect resolution, but it pays a heavy price. Its non-local nature creates "ghost" artifacts or "cross-terms" that appear in the middle of nowhere, halfway in time and frequency between real signal components. Understanding the mathematical nature of your representation is key to interpreting the picture it produces.
This idea of choosing the right lens is most apparent when we talk about choosing a basis—a set of fundamental shapes, or "atoms," out of which we build our signal. Problem 2449853 stages a classic duel between two of the most important bases. In one corner, we have the Discrete Fourier Transform (DFT) basis, whose atoms are the eternal, perfectly smooth sine and cosine waves. In the other, we have the Haar wavelet basis, whose atoms are short, choppy, localized block-like wiggles. Which is better? It depends entirely on the signal you are trying to describe. A pure musical tone, being a sine wave itself, can be described with just one or two Fourier atoms but requires a whole committee of wavelets to approximate. Conversely, a signal with a sharp, sudden change—a click in an audio track or a sharp edge in an image—is perfectly captured by a single, localized wavelet atom but requires a near-infinite sum of smooth sine waves (the Gibbs phenomenon) to describe in the Fourier world.
The goal is to find a representation in which the signal is sparse—that is, describable with the fewest possible non-zero coefficients. This principle of sparsity is the engine behind all modern compression, from MP3s to JPEGs. The different philosophies of Fourier and wavelets manifest in practical tools like filter banks. DFT-based filter banks chop the frequency spectrum into uniform, equal-width channels, ideal for applications like telecommunications. Wavelet-based filter banks use a logarithmic, octave-band structure, providing high time resolution for high-frequency events and high frequency resolution for low-frequency phenomena. This multiresolution analysis is perfectly suited for natural signals like images and sounds.
And what if no off-the-shelf basis is quite right? Advanced signal processing shows us we can even engineer our own representations. We can create overcomplete dictionaries—a vocabulary with more "words" than strictly necessary—to find even sparser ways to describe a signal. For instance, to combat the fact that a standard wavelet basis is not shift-invariant, we can create a dictionary containing wavelets at every possible shift, ensuring we always have an atom that lines up perfectly with a feature, no matter where it occurs.
Finally, let us zoom out from single signals to entire systems of interacting components. Think of a complex control system, an electrical circuit, or even an economic model. We can represent such systems as a signal flow graph, a drawing where signals are nodes and the processes that transform them are directed, weighted arrows connecting them. A dense web of algebraic equations becomes an intuitive picture, a network that we can analyze visually.
This graphical representation allows us to see the structure of feedback loops and pathways. But it also hides a deep connection to physical reality. For a system to be causal and well-posed—for it to be a valid description of a real-world process—it cannot contain instantaneous feedback loops where an output can determine its own value in the exact same instant. This would be like an effect preceding its cause. In the language of signal flow graphs, this physical constraint translates into a clean, crisp condition on the system's gain matrix, : the matrix must be invertible. If this condition fails, it means the graph contains an algebraic loop that cannot be resolved in time. This is a breathtaking example of how an abstract mathematical representation, born of graph theory and linear algebra, must still bow to the fundamental laws of causality and the unidirectional arrow of time.
Our tour is complete. We have seen that "signal representation" is not a single subject but a vast and creative art form. It is the art of choosing the right language to describe a piece of the world, whether it's to store music on a chip, decode a radio wave from across the planet, compress a photograph, or ensure a robot arm moves just right. The inherent beauty lies not in finding a single, ultimate truth, but in mastering a diverse palette of descriptions and having the wisdom to choose the one that makes the complex simple and the invisible clear.